This report provides a detailed comparison of the cost of living and quality of life between Podgorica, Montenegro, and Ho Chi Minh City, Vietnam, based on available data. While Podgorica offers a higher quality of life in several key areas, Ho Chi Minh City presents significantly lower costs for most living expenses, making it a more affordable option despite potential trade-offs in certain quality metrics.
The cost of living in Ho Chi Minh City is substantially lower than in Podgorica across nearly all categories. Basic food items, transportation, utilities, and housing are all considerably cheaper in Vietnam. For example, groceries for two people cost approximately 40% less, public transportation is 80% cheaper, and rent for a 3-bedroom apartment is about 40% less. Even dining out and entertainment expenses are significantly reduced. This makes Ho Chi Minh City an extremely affordable option for residents, particularly for international expatriates seeking a lower cost of living.
Podgorica generally scores higher on quality of life metrics. The city maintains a higher safety index (70 vs. 49), cleaner air (lower pollution index), and better climate conditions (higher climate index). Healthcare quality is also rated higher in Podgorica. While Ho Chi Minh City offers modern amenities and a vibrant city atmosphere, these advantages are partially offset by higher pollution levels and lower safety ratings. The overall impression is that Podgorica provides a more comfortable and secure living environment, albeit at a higher cost.

Real estate & living comparison
| Podgorica | Ho Chi Minh City | |
|---|---|---|
| Price per Square Meter to Buy Apartment Outside of Centre | 2286.02 USD | 1923.43 USD |
| 1 Bedroom Apartment Outside of City Centre | 498.93 USD | 306.38 USD |
| 3 Bedroom Apartment Outside of City Centre | 913.82 USD | 669.9 USD |
| Average Monthly Net Salary (After Tax) | 1172 USD | 496.98 USD |
| GDP Growth Rate: | 6.34 USD | 5.05 USD |
| Monthly Public Transport Pass (Regular Price) | 35.06 USD | 11.46 USD |
| Basic Utilities for 85 m2 Apartment (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water, Garbage) | 121.35 USD | 95.09 USD |
| Population | 172,139 | 15,136,000 |
